对于Dijkstra算法(标号法),说法错误的是( )。
A: 可以求无向图的最短路问题
B: 可以求有向图的最短路问题
C: 能求出网络中一点到其他点间最短距离
D: 能求出网络中任两点间的最短距离
A: 可以求无向图的最短路问题
B: 可以求有向图的最短路问题
C: 能求出网络中一点到其他点间最短距离
D: 能求出网络中任两点间的最短距离
举一反三
- 在下列有关Dijkstra方法的论述中,哪一个是正确的 ?? 对于给定的有向图D,利用标号法至多经过p步,就可以求出从vs到各点的最短路;|对于给定的有向图D,利用标号法至少经过p−1步,才可以求出从vs到各点的最短路;|对于给定的有向图D,利用标号法至多经过p−1步,就可以求出从vs到各点的最短路;|对于给定的有向图D,利用标号法至少经过p步,才可以求出从vs到各点的最短路。
- 关于Dijkstra算法,以下说法正确的是()。 A: Dijkstra算法既可以用于求解单源最短路径问题,也可以用于求解单终点最短路径问题 B: 有向图和无向图都可以使用Dijkstra算法来求单源最短路径 C: 在Dijkstra算法中,通过松弛操作来更新源点到其他顶点的距离 D: 如果图中存在权重为负数的边,也可以使用Dijkstra算法进行求解
- 下列关于Dijkstra算法的哪些说法正确? Dijkstra算法对边权无要求。|Dijkstra算法是求加权图G中从某固定起点到其余各点最短路径的有效算法;|Dijkstra算法的时间复杂度为O(n2),其中n为顶点数;|Dijkstra算法可用于求解无向图、有向图和混合图的最短路径问题;
- 关于最短路算法(迪杰斯屈拉算法),下列论述正确的有( )。 A: 算法可以解决有向图中指定两顶点间的最短通路问题。 B: 算法的时间复杂度是O(n3)。 C: 算法结束时的顶点标号就是到达该顶点的最短通路长度。 D: 算法的每次运行可以求出任意顶点对间的最短通路长度。
- 下列关于Dijkstra算法的哪些说法不正确的是( ) A: Dijkstra算法的时间复杂度为O(n2),其中n为顶点数。 B: Dijkstra算法可用于求解无向图、有向图和混合图的最短路径问题。 C: Dijkstra算法是求加权图G中从某固定起点到其余各点最短路径的有效算法。 D: Dijkstra算法对边权无要求。